'93 500E Battery Drain, Fuse #9, Symptoms Listed

The 500E has developed a problem recently and I'm having a tough time sorting it out. I have a battery drain that's taking place through the following lamps with the key removed:
E20 Exterior Lamp Switch Illumination
E10/2 Left Air Outlet Illumination
E12 Trans Selector Illumination
E10/3 Right Air Outlet Illumination
? Rear Head Rest Illumination
? Rear Sunshade Illumination
? Left Seat Memory Illumination

In addition the Radio functions w/o the key in the ignition.

If Fuse #9 is removed the draw on the battery stops.

I'm hoping that someone has had this problem in the past and can point me in the right direction. I have tried disconnecting the CD player, Power Antenna, Audio Amplifier, and Door/Hood/Trunk Switches, but this has had no effect on the draw. Any ideas here? I'm gradually pulling the car apart chasing this thing and can't say that I enjoy pasting wiring diagrams together from 8 1/2 x 11 print outs! Thanks in advance for any help !

I'd read that thread a few days back and checked most of the items listed. I did measure the draw across fuse 9, it's .39-.40A. I'm diving into the dash to check some items today.

UPDATE: Just found the "Control Unit, Instrument Switch Lighting". It's some type of fancy relay with P/N 003 545 63 32. This has been replaced by P/N 004 545 08 32 according to the dealer. Anyone know how to test one of these things? It's connected to the problem interior lamps and I suspect it may be toast.

all the stuff you have listed is running from a feed at the light switch for parking lights.the relay you found could certainly be the culprit.try disconnecting the wire to terminal 30 on the relay and see if draw goes away.

Removed the Control Unit completely and powered up the car. The instrument lights go out, BUT the radio still functions! I've unplugged both amps and this had no effect. I'm going to try uplugging the head unit and see what happens. If that does nothing I'll take a run at the headlamp switch, once I figure out how to remove it!

UPDATE: Removed or Unplugged entire Radio Assembly (head unit, amps, cd, tuner). No change, still have draw. Called Becker NA for some advice. Told the Radio Assembly is set up to stay on for 1hr. after ign. is turned off (?!). Either way, I still have the draw of the instrument lamps. I'm inclined to get the Becker looked at for other reasons, but the insturment lamps are driving me nuts! Control Unit is looking more suspicious...

Problem was the headlamp switch. Thanks for the suggestions and help!
